You can lower your insurance premium considerably by choosing the highest deductible offered. A higher deductible means that you will have to pay for repairs required when minor accidents occur, but you are still protected in the case of a major accident or one in which liability rests on you. If you have a car that is of little value, the sensible choice is to pay a high deductible.

You might be able to save money on your car insurance by joining in on a group rate plan available through the company you work for. Many employers have special agreements with insurance companies, and they offer great group rates to their employees. There are also different levels of discounts, so make sure to ask which discounts you are eligible for. Length of employment, for example, may affect the rate you pay. If you company does not currently participate, recommend it to them.

Your monthly insurance cost is determined by the kind of truck or car that you buy. If you can’t be seen without a Lexus or a BMW, you’ll pay high premiums. If saving money is your primary concern, a modest vehicle will be your safest choice.

Know exactly what you want and need before you start insurance shopping. Individual states have different requirements, but basic insurance terminology and concepts remain the same. Know the terminology when you are shopping for a policy so that you can comfortably discuss features with an agent.

It is important to notify law enforcement after you have a car accident. Police officers know what type of information to obtain, and they can guide you on what steps to take when you get home. Police intervention can help you later on when you are contacting your insurance agent. Notify the police as soon as possible.
